Swiss tennis maestro Roger Federer bid farewell to professional tennis last week after he played his last match at the Laver Cup. Playing alongside long-time rival Rafael Nadal while representing Team Europe, Federer did not have the best possible result, as the duo ended up losing their match. Taking to Instagram, Federer highlighted how he lost his last doubles, singles and team event. He also advised not to overthink that "perfect ending".

Spaniards Carlos Alcaraz and Rafael Nadal will make history when they become the top two ranked players in the world on Monday. Casper Ruud’s defeat to Yoshihito Nishioka in the quarter-finals of the Korea Open on Friday will see him surrender the No. 2 spot to Nadal when the ATP rankings are updated.
